War On Terror: The phrase is actually now a misnomer. Iraq and Afghanistan have been rebranded the “Overseas Contingency Operation,” and lawyers are being deployed to fight the real battles.

The strategy of the new administration looks a lot like the course the Clinton administration set us on before Sept. 11, 2001. And we know how that turned out: Clinton relied on prosecutors to fight terrorists, mistakenly treating terrorism as random crime rather than the grave national security threat that it is.
